It is encouraging that youthful ladies, on the whole, seem to be much less tolerant of accomplice violence and extra willing than women of their moms’ generation to finish a relationship as soon as it turns into violent. This difference is probably because of a cohort or time effect, reflecting the modifications in cultural attitudes and sources for abused ladies in Nicaragua during the past 30 years. Through the Eighties, when Nicaragua was governed by the revolutionary Sandinista party, girls had been encouraged to educate themselves and to take part in social and financial development. The promotion of gender fairness was additionally a acknowledged purpose of the Sandinista government, though particular resources for battered ladies violence were restricted.

A direct response to shifting public coverage, The Working and Unemployed Girls’s Movement or Maria Elena Cuadra (MEC), was founded in 1994. This independent group strives to not only defend the human, labor and gender rights of Nicaraguan girls but also to assist girls assert and benefit from these rights, especially throughout the legal arena.

A whole lot of protesters have been arbitrarily arrested and detained, many for several months. As of February 2019, the Inter-American Commission on Human Rights (IACHR) documented a minimum of 777 individuals arrested throughout the crackdown. Many have been subject to torture and different ailing-remedy, including electrical shocks, severe beatings, fingernail removal, asphyxiation, and rape.

In the household, boys are compelled to identify with an energetic-aggressive masculinity and negate everything outlined as “feminine,” particularly emotions. By the age of 5-6, the premise of masculinity has already been established in boys for life. This disdain in the direction of the female makes them really feel an ambivalence in direction of women that’s later expressed as resentment and aggression. Women, on the other hand, are compelled to be passive. The household is an brisk and efficient mechanism for creating and transmitting gender inequalities. Since each socioeconomic system creates a particular sort of family, and family construction in flip performs an essential position in forming social ideology, the ideology of the Nicaraguan household has a hegemonic place inside society as a complete.
